Bijjaram - Kosgi, Narayanpet
Bijjaram is a village situated in the Kosgi mandal of Narayanpet district, Telangana. It is located approximately 4 km from Kosgi and around 50 km from Mahbubnagar. Bijjaram village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Bijjaram is 574957. The village covers a total geographical area of 599 hectares and falls under the 509339 pincode. Tandur is the nearest town, located about 41 km away.
Bijjaram village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Bijjaram
As per Census 2011, Bijjaram village has a total population of 1,104 people, consisting of 542 males and 562 females. The village has 209 households and a sex ratio of 1,036 females per 1,000 males. There are 146 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 446 literate and 658 illiterate residents. Additionally, 181 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Bijjaram
Bijjaram is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Tandur to Bijjaram is about 41 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.2 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Mahbubnagar to Bijjaram is about 50 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.4 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
